How to Store Magic Baked Shrimp Leftovers

  • Quick Refrigeration Strategy: Store leftover shrimp in an airtight container within 2 hours of cooking, keeping the dish chilled at 40°F or below to maintain food safety and quality.
  • Smart Reheating Technique: Warm refrigerated shrimp gently in the oven at 275°F for 10-12 minutes, covering with foil to prevent drying out and preserve the delicate texture of the seafood.
  • Freezer-Friendly Option: Package cooled shrimp in freezer-safe containers, separating layers with parchment paper, and freeze for up to 2 weeks. Thaw overnight in the refrigerator before reheating.
  • Meal Prep Advantage: Prepare the shrimp mixture and breadcrumb topping separately in advance, storing them in sealed containers in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ours before final baking, making weeknight dinners a breeze.

Tips for Lemon Butter Shrimp Success

  • Replace shrimp with white fish like cod or halibut for a seafood variation that keeps the magical sauce intact.
  • Add red pepper flakes, cayenne, or smoked paprika to the breadcrumb mixture for a zesty kick that transforms the flavor profile.
  • Serve over pasta, rice, or roasted vegetables to turn this recipe into a complete and satisfying dinner that everyone will love.
  • Assemble the entire dish up to 24 hours in advance, storing covered in the refrigerator, then bake directly when ready to serve for maximum convenience and minimal kitchen stress.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b (454 g) sh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• ¾ cup (180 ml) chicken broth
  • 5 tbsps (75 ml) unsalted butter, melted
  • 2 tbsps (30 ml) lemon juice
  • ¾ cup (60 g) panko breadcrumbs
  • 1.5 tbsps (22 ml) olive oil
  • ¼ cup (25 g) Parmesan cheese, shredded
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• ¼ tsp salt
  • Salt to taste
  • P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Preheat: Crank the oven to a sizzling 430°F, creating the ideal thermal environment for seafood transformation.
  2. Liquid Foundation: Infuse a casserole dish with chicken broth and half the melted butter, roasting for 10 minutes to concentrate and intensify the flavor profile.
  3. Shrimp Preparation: Lavishly coat shrimp with remaining melted butter, aromatic garlic, zesty lemon juice, and a strategic sprinkle of salt and pepper, ensuring comprehensive flavor absorption.
  4. Assembly: Remove the pre-heated dish and strategically arrange shrimp across the reduced liquid landscape, guaranteeing uniform heat distribution and maximum flavor infusion.
  5. Crispy Topping: Craft a textural masterpiece by blending panko breadcrumbs with Parmesan cheese, introducing olive oil and a whisper of salt to create a golden, crunchy armor.
  6. Culinary Transformation: Blanket the shrimp with the breadcrumb mixture, then return to the oven for 12 minutes until shrimp turn opaque and succulent.
  7. Final Flourish: Activate the broiler for 1-2 minutes, monitoring closely to achieve a stunning golden-brown crust without scorching the delicate seafood.
  8. Presentation: Serve immediately, potentially adorning with fresh herbs or vibrant lemon wedges to elevate the dish’s sensory experience and visual allure.
